In March to the Majority, New York Times bestselling author Newt Gingrich takes readers behind the scenes of the Republican Revolution in 1994 and the rise of the modern GOP.
 
The story of Gingrich's rise from college professor, to architect of the Contract with America, to Speaker of the U.S. House of Representatives is historic. There were many adventures, personalities, missteps, and victories on the road from a seemingly permanent House GOP minority to the first Republican majority in 40 years. These untold stories and inspiring lessons about the rise of modern conservatism are immensely relevant today as the United States faces profound and extraordinary challenges.

Speaker of the House Newt Gingrich joins with former National Republican Congressional Committee Executive Director Joe Gaylord to bring alive the stories, events, and activities that led to the Contract with America and the first re-elected Republican majority since 1928. No two people are better positioned to tell this story than Gingrich and Gaylord. They were there, and they got it done. 

Gingrich and Gaylord share never-before-told stories about:

Ronald Reagan Richard Nixon Tip O'Neill George H.W. Bush Bill Clinton, and other pivotal political figures March to the Majority is not only about the past, but also about the challenges our nation faces today and offers principles for governing the American people.

As stated in March to the Majority’s introduction, the Contract with America, and historic Republican Revolution of 1994 was achieved through “…constant work, cheerful persistence over enormous frustration, learning and adapting, and experimenting…”. This book is more than a memoir or an autobiography due to it explaining how the hard work and political, policy, and legislative principles that led to the staggering successes and achievements of the first reelected GOP House Republican majority in 68 years (since 1928) is still applicable today and should be applied by the current GOP Congressional House leadership.

Gingrich and Gaylord make it clear at the outset that everyday Americans are the true agents of change for a better America, reminding the reader what President Reagan used to say: we want to shine a light on the American people, so they can turn up the heat on Congress.

Although more a playbook than a memoir, the book serves as a very important chronicle of the events leading up to the first GOP House majority in forty years (since 1954). Mr. Gingrich's ‘I was there’ commentary provides a riveting reminiscing of the chain of events that transpired.

Mr. Gingrich's ‘I was there’ commentary provides for a riveting reminiscence of the chain of events that transpired, starting with his experiences with the Harrisburg PA zoo at the age of 11:
"...This became one of those accidents of history that convinced me that you could not do anything big or important without first learning a lot of facts..."
-Invaluable insights garnered from General Edward Charles “Shy” Meyer, the chief of staff of the U.S. Army and Colonel Calloway of the U.S. Army’s Grafenwoehr Training Area.
-Reflections on the pivotal 1978 Georgia campaign, from being down 51% to 37% at the beginning of September to winning 54.4% to 45.59%.
-Insights from Chester Gibson on debating and lessons learned from the 1984 Mondale vs. Reagan campaign.

Winding up the book are three appendices that combines a wealth of strategic political knowledge with co-author Joe Gaylord's years of experience:
-Meet Joe Gaylord (Mr. Gaylord's career from 1968 to present)
-Gaylord's Lessons for Success
-Gaylord's Six Keys to Building a Majority
This is a multi-faceted publication that is extremely interesting to read from a historical perspective as well as being a vital national politics reference for elite professional campaigning.
